Scripture: “After consulting the people, Jehoshaphat appointed men to sing to the LORD and to praise him for the splendor of his holiness as they went out at the head of the army, saying: ‘Give thanks to the LORD, for his love endures forever.’ As they began to sing and praise, the LORD set ambushes against the men of Ammon and Moab and Mount Seir who were invading Judah, and they were defeated.” — 2 Chronicles 20:21-22 (NIV)

Devotional Thoughts


Life often feels like a battlefield. We face overwhelming challenges—financial struggles, sickness, broken relationships, or uncertainty about the future. Our natural instinct is to fight back with human strategies: worry, fear, and self-reliance. But God’s way is different. He calls us to use a powerful, unconventional weapon: praise.


King Jehoshaphat and the people of Judah faced an impossible situation. Three mighty armies were marching against them. Outnumbered and unprepared for war, Jehoshaphat turned to the Lord in prayer, confessing, “We do not know what to do, but our eyes are on you” (2 Chronicles 20:12). In response, God gave an astonishing battle plan: send the worshippers ahead of the warriors.


Imagine going into battle with no swords, shields, or bows—just songs of thanksgiving! Yet, as they lifted their voices in praise, God Himself fought for them. The enemy armies turned against each other and were completely destroyed. Judah didn’t even have to lift a finger!


This story teaches us a profound truth: praise is a spiritual weapon that invites God’s power into our battles. When we praise God, we shift our focus from the size of our problem to the greatness of our God. Praise acknowledges that He is in control, no matter how dire the situation seems.
